"Interconnected" an Artessa Alliance group exhibition at the Awbury Arboretum
January 2- February 26, 2023
Awbury Arboretum
The Francis Cope House
One Awbury Road
Philadelphia, PA 19138
Interconnected features artwork by Artessa Alliance members
Brenda Howell
,
Colleen Hammond
,
Elena Drozdova
,
Julia Way
,
Karen Hunter McLaughlin
,
Kimberly Mehler
,
Megan Raab Greenholt
,
Nancy Agati
,
Nathalie Borozny
, and
Rebecca Schultz
, reflecting each artist’s relationship with the more-than-human world.
Some works are based on close observation of nature; others are inspired by natural forms and systems. Many incorporate foraged and natural materials. Through a variety of styles and media, Interconnected is a creative meditation on the web of life.
